Integrated 25-Litre Fuel Tank
The 701 LR has a special fuel setup. It has a 13-litre rear tank and a 12-litre front tank, adding up to 25 litres. This setup lets riders go about 500 kilometers without needing to refuel.
Switching between tanks is easy, keeping the fuel flowing. The extra tank and fuel add 9 kg to the bike. This helps keep it stable and balanced on long rides.
Powerful 692.7cc Engine
The heart of the Husqvarna 701 LR is its 692.7cc single-cylinder engine. It packs 74 horsepower and 73 Nm of torque. This engine gives smooth power and great performance on any terrain.
Whether you’re tackling tough trails or cruising on the highway, the bike responds well. It has two rider modes for different riding conditions. This makes it perfect for any adventure.

Understanding the Husqvarna 701 LR Specs
The Husqvarna 701 LR is a marvel of engineering. It’s built for long rides and off-road adventures. This bike is perfect for any rider, thanks to its versatility.
The bike’s fuel range is impressive. It can go up to 310 miles on a single tank. With a 12-liter front tank, the total capacity is 25 liters (6.6 gallons). This makes it great for long trips.
The engine is the bike’s heart. It’s a 692.7 cc single-cylinder, four-stroke engine that makes 55 kW (73.8 hp). It performs well on both city streets and rough terrains. The 6-speed transmission and APTC (TM) slipper clutch ensure smooth shifting.
Stopping power is key, and the Husqvarna 701 LR delivers. It has a Brembo twin-piston floating caliper with a 300 mm brake disc in the front. The rear has a single-piston caliper with a 240 mm brake disc. The Bosch 9ME combined ABS system adds to the safety.
The suspension system is designed for off-road. It offers 250 mm of travel at both ends. This allows for smooth handling on different terrains. The seat height of 925 mm (36.4 inches) and ground clearance of 270 mm fit many riders.
The bike weighs 155 kg (341.7 lbs) without fuel. It’s light enough for agility but sturdy enough for durability. This makes it a top choice for those looking for a capable dual sport motorcycle.
